Formulation optimization of polyaspartic is a precise, systematic process aimed at balancing performance, application properties, cost, and environmental requirements. The core of this process involves adjusting component ratios, incorporating functional additives, selecting novel raw materials, and optimizing process parameters to enhance the overall performance of the coating.
Reactivity Control:
Selecting resin combinations with varying substituents (R1, R2) and molecular weights (e.g., fast-curing plus slow-curing) precisely controls gel time (adjustable from minutes to tens of minutes).
Optimization Direction:
Extending application windows while ensuring quick drying (walkable in 1-2 hours).

Rigorous testing required for optimization:
Precise Requirement Definition: Clearly prioritizing coating core performance (e.g., abrasion resistance for flooring, impact resistance for wind power).
Synergistic Component Interaction: Avoid additive interactions canceling out benefits (e.g., excessive silane leveling agents can reduce adhesion).
Dynamic Iteration: Rapid optimal ratio screening via DOE (Design of Experiments), combined with validation in application scenarios.
Through continuous optimization, polyaspartic is progressively surpassing performance limits, advancing towards higher durability, smarter construction, and greater environmental sustainability.
